In this episode of “Planet Money” titled “Econ Battle Zone: Disinflation Confrontation,” three reporters compete in a challenge to become experts in various economic concepts. They have 48 hours to impress the judges and win the title of Econ Battle Zone champion. The podcast takes a humorous approach to discussing economics and aims to make science accessible to all listeners.
In the Econ Battle Zone competition, the reporters are challenged to explain economic concepts in a delightful way. They have to incorporate mystery ingredients like explaining the concept to a child, recording in a public place, and using metaphors. However, they face difficulties in finding the right interviewees and simplifying complex economic concepts. Erica struggles to find a child to explain “labor hoarding,” while Amanda aims to secure an interview with the president of the New York Federal Reserve Bank.
Erica presents a children’s mini-Planet Money podcast to explain labor hoarding. She incorporates a child co-host and an economist’s input to make the concept accessible. Labor hoarding refers to employers keeping workers during slow economic times, as it may be challenging to find new workers with the same skills later on. The global supply chain, often overlooked until recently, is crucial to the economy. It is currently experiencing disinflation, which is the decrease in the rate of inflation. The COVID-19 pandemic and Russia’s invasion of Ukraine disrupted the supply chain, leading to shortages and inflation. The Federal Reserve intervened by raising interest rates to lower inflation. However, the supply chain is slowly recovering, and inflation is expected to decrease without causing massive unemployment or recession.
